Birdwatchers, hikers, and local residents often act as the first line of observation in regions rich with biodiversity. By documenting what they see—whether through notes, photographs, or videos—they can provide valuable information to researchers.

For those interested in contributing responsibly, there are a few simple practices to follow:

  • Record the date, time, and location of the sighting
  • Note weather conditions and visibility
  • Describe the bird’s size, shape, and behavior as accurately as possible
  • Take photos or videos if it can be done without disturbing the animal

This kind of detailed information can help scientists compare reports and identify patterns that might otherwise go unnoticed.


The Challenge of Identifying Birds in Flight

Even experienced ornithologists acknowledge that identifying birds in flight can be difficult. Factors such as distance, lighting, and angle all influence how a bird appears to the human eye.

Large birds of prey, in particular, can be tricky to distinguish. Their silhouettes may look similar when soaring at high altitudes, and subtle differences in wing shape or movement can be hard to detect without close observation.

In some cases, birds may appear significantly larger than they actually are. This can happen when they fly closer to the observer than expected or when there are no nearby objects for size comparison.

Because of these challenges, scientists rely on multiple forms of evidence before confirming a species. A single sighting—no matter how detailed—is rarely enough on its own.


Migration Patterns and Unexpected Visitors

The possibility of a rare or out-of-range bird appearing in South Texas is not as unlikely as it might seem. Migration patterns are influenced by a wide range of factors, including weather systems, food availability, and environmental changes.

Strong winds or storms can push birds far off course, leading them to appear in unfamiliar regions. In some cases, these unexpected journeys result in sightings that excite both researchers and bird enthusiasts.

The Rio Grande Valley is especially known for this phenomenon. Its location makes it a natural crossroads for species traveling between North and South America. This unique positioning increases the chances of rare sightings, even if they occur only occasionally.

Understanding the Limits of Human Perception

Another important takeaway from this story is how easily perception can be influenced by environmental factors. Humans are not always accurate at judging size, especially when objects are viewed at a distance or against an open sky.

A bird flying high overhead can appear larger or smaller depending on light conditions, angle, and even background contrast. Without nearby reference points, estimating wingspan becomes especially difficult.

This is not a flaw—it’s simply a limitation of how human vision works. Recognizing these limitations is part of what makes scientific investigation so important. By combining observation with measurement tools, researchers can move from perception to evidence.


Why Rare Sightings Matter

Even when unusual sightings turn out to have ordinary explanations, they still play an important role in science. Each report adds to a growing body of knowledge about species distribution, migration, and behavior.

For example, if a bird appears outside its typical range, it may indicate changes in environmental conditions. These shifts can be linked to factors such as climate patterns, habitat changes, or food availability.

Tracking these occurrences over time helps scientists identify trends that might otherwise go unnoticed. In this way, even a single sighting can contribute to a much larger picture.


Ethical Wildlife Observation

As interest in the story continues to grow, experts emphasize the importance of observing wildlife responsibly. Increased attention can sometimes lead people to unintentionally disturb natural habitats.

To avoid this, wildlife officials recommend maintaining a respectful distance from animals and avoiding actions that could disrupt their routines. This includes staying on designated trails, keeping noise levels low, and refraining from attempting to approach or feed wild animals.

Photography should also be done carefully. Using zoom lenses instead of getting physically closer helps protect both the observer and the animal.

Responsible behavior ensures that research can continue without harming the very ecosystems people are trying to understand.
